What Is Countertop Paint?

Using a roller to apply white basecoat to a brown countertop.

Tired of those outdated countertops but not ready for a kitchen or bathroom renovation? Countertop paint might be the perfect solution. Countertop paint is a specialized coating that allows you to transform worn, dated surfaces without the expense of replacement.

Countertop paint is a durable coating designed for high-traffic surfaces like kitchen and bathroom counters. Unlike regular wall paint, a countertop coating is formulated to withstand daily use, moisture, heat and cleaning products while providing an attractive finish.

Why Paint a Countertop?

Painting your countertops offers several benefits:

  • Cost savings. While new countertops can cost thousands of dollars, a complete countertop paint kit is a fraction of the price. This makes it an excellent option for budget-conscious homeowners or those looking to update rental properties.
  • Quick transformation. Most countertop painting projects can be completed in a single day.
  • Customization. You can choose from various countertop colors and finishes, including options that replicate the look of natural stone, concrete or other premium materials.

What Kinds of Countertops Can You Paint?

You can paint countertops that are bare, stained, sealed or previously coated. These include laminate, melamine, ceramic tile, porcelain tile and wood countertops.

It’s important to note that porous surfaces like natural stone should not be painted. This includes marble and granite countertops.

Can You Paint Countertops with Wall Paint?

Wall paint cannot withstand the wear and tear that countertops endure. That’s why it’s important to use a countertop paint system like a Rust-Oleum HOME Countertop Coating Kit. The kit’s countertop coating is specifically formulated for durability. It’s also a popular choice because it’s easy to apply and does not require priming, sanding or stripping any previous coatings.

Each kit includes:

  • A cleaning solution to use before you paint.
  • A basecoat that provides color and coverage.
  • A protective topcoat that resists scratches, stains and heat.

Rust-Oleum HOME Countertop Coating Kits come in a white tint base and a deep tint base, allowing you to choose from a spectrum of countertop colors. Simply have your kit’s basecoat tinted to your favorite color at the store’s paint counter.

How Do You Apply Countertop Paint?

Once you've chosen your Rust-Oleum HOME Countertop Coating system, be sure to follow the detailed instructions included with the kit for best results.

The kit’s instructions will lead you through the following steps:

  1. Clean the surface thoroughly. Rinse the surface and allow it to dry.
  2. Use painter’s tape to cover surrounding areas you don’t want coat.
  3. Apply the basecoat using a paint roller or brush.
  4. Apply the protective topcoat for added durability.

How Do You Make a Marbled Countertop?

If you don’t want a solid countertop color, consider giving it a marbled look. A Rust-Oleum HOME Marble Countertop Coating Kit lets you refinish your countertops with the appearance of marble.

After cleaning the countertop and applying the countertop basecoat, add designs with the included marble veining paint before finishing with the protective topcoat. Be sure to follow the recommended dry times on your product label.
